Why a Local Fort Myers Lender Matters for Your FHA Loan
A national online lender might offer a quick quote, but a local FHA expert brings indispensable value to the table. They have firsthand experience with appraisals in our specific neighborhoods, from the historic streets of Dean Park to the newer developments in Gateway. They understand the common issues that can arise with Florida homes, such as older roofs or hurricane-impact insurance considerations, and can guide you through the FHA appraisal process with that local context. Furthermore, a lender with a physical presence in Lee County is more likely to be familiar with regional down payment assistance programs that can be layered with your FHA loan, potentially making homeownership even more accessible.
Your Actionable Plan for Finding FHA Lenders Near You
Start your search by looking beyond a simple "FHA loan lenders near me" Google query. Ask your trusted local real estate agent for referrals; they work with lenders daily and know who provides smooth closings. Visit the websites of established local credit unions, like those based in Southwest Florida, as they often have competitive FHA rates and a strong community focus. Don't hesitate to schedule consultations with two or three recommended lenders. Come prepared to ask specific questions: "What is your experience with FHA loans in Fort Myers?" "Can you explain how flood insurance requirements in this ZIP code will affect my monthly payment?" "Are you familiar with the Florida HFA (Housing Finance Corporation) programs that offer assistance to FHA borrowers?"
A Key Florida-Specific Consideration: Insurance
This is crucial for your budget. Florida's insurance landscape is unique. Your FHA-required mortgage insurance (MIP) is one cost, but you must also factor in Florida homeowners insurance and, in many parts of Fort Myers, mandatory flood insurance. A savvy local lender will help you estimate these costs accurately from the start, so there are no surprises at closing and you can shop for homes within your true budget.
